I started playing Terraria back in 2011 and loved it instantly. I enjoy playing games that allow for exploration and creative expression, and Terraria certainly fits the bill. However, I didn't begin serious engineering until early 2014. Once I started doing a lot of research, learning as much as I could from the wiki and from various guides on the old Terraria Online forums, and learning by trial and error, I ended up creating a wide variety of autofarms throughout 2014.
